Prep: Warm shower
Brush: C&H 'Casanova' Fanchurian
Soap: Tabac
Razor: Stirling SS HA
Blade: Gillette Silver Blue
Post: Cold Water and Tabac After Shave

Another good shave, a little more confident. I'm finding that the safety bar on this razor has very little to do with the shave, occasional touch down on the skin but may as well just be the top cap. After 1 pass I could have called it a day, I think this HA is something you would use after you've been stuck in the wilderness for a month or two. None of this is negative in any way shape or form, just an observation. Two instances of blood drawn on the chin and underside of my jaw, stopped immediately without intervention so nothing major. I'll give this HA one more shout then I'll try the standard.

My only negative so far is perhaps the handle, where it sits comfortably in my hand it is right on the lower smooth portion. Which if there's any slickness resulted in a couple of dicey moments. I was warned about the handle size so this doesn't come as a surprise. It works just as well though by holding the end for me, but it is very top heavy so need to completely lay off any pressure.
